Pay it Forward – Rock N’ Rolled Ice Cream

I am happy to present to you our twelfth local business spotlighted in the Pay it Forward feature – Rock N’ Rolled Ice Cream.

Our recent Lake County business featured was Jon Martin & Nick Hough, owners of Stitched Designs LLC, who chose to Pay it Forward to Baylee Grove, owner of Rock N’ Rolled Ice Cream.

The catch is that I will not choose the next business to interview, but the current spotlighted business will choose who I will interview next. Local businesses will Pay it Forward.

Rock N’ Rolled Ice Cream is a locally owned and operated custom ice cream shop with fresh ice cream made and rolled right in front of you. They make their five bases – vanilla, chocolate, matcha, coffee and salted caramel in house every day, along with waffle tacos, crepes, and paninis.

They also provide a vegan option. With 5-star reviews and toppings through the roof, milkshakes, floats and a variety of delicious drinks, sauces, and infused flavors – Rock N’ Rolled Ice Cream is a must-visit.

Summer is here! You know where to satisfy your cravings on these hot days. Baylee’s ice cream shop is located in Hidden Valley Lake and has achieved a high positive rating from their customers.

1. Why did you decide to start your own business?

Ever since I was a little girl, my fondest memories were going to ice cream shops with my family and making happy memories. I wanted to bring it to our community so that everyone can experience the same joy it brought me as a child. 

2. How do you deal with fear and doubt?

Whenever I have fear or doubt, when it comes to my business, I go to my mom and she reassures me everything will be okay.

3. How does your business look different now vs. when you first started?

When I first started Rock N Rolled it was just mobile. I went to any event that I could go to – now I have a shop in Hidden Valley. 

4. How do you set your business apart from others in your industry?

What sets me apart from anyone else is that not only is the ice cream freshly made every day, but you also get to watch your ice cream get made right in front of you. You can also get creative and create your own ice cream flavor. I really wanted to create a unique experience unlike anything else.

5. What is the hardest part of being an entrepreneur?

In my opinion, the hardest part of being an entrepreneur is never having a day off, as well as trying to balance my personal life with my shop open. Also, trying to make sure that my shop runs smoothly without me there.

6. What is your favorite part of being an entrepreneur?

My favorite part of being an entrepreneur is that I can have any creativity with my business, and I can take it as far as I want to, as well as seeing all the happy faces once they consume my product.

7. If you could travel anywhere in the world, where would it be and why?

If I could travel anywhere in the world, it would be Italy. I would love to see all the scenery, visiting my foreign exchange brother, along with trying all of the food they have to offer.
